[Bug 1895781] Re: ~/.gnomerc is not loaded anymore at startup

2022-10-20 Thread Kentaro
The same issue has been reproduced in Jammy (22.04.1).

The following patch for 55gnome-session_gnomerc is a workaround that
fixes this issue.

5c5
< if [ "$BASESTARTUP" = x-session-manager ]; then
---
> if [ "$BASESTARTUP" = x-session-manager ] || [ "$BASESTARTUP" = env ]; then

[Bug 1993634] [NEW] network-manager-openvpn: --cipher option deprecated in OpenVPN 2.6, no option to set suggested --data-ciphers flag instead

2022-10-20 Thread Franck
Public bug reported:

Latest network-manager-openvpn still uses the deprecated --cipher
option, and offers no way to set the new --data-ciphers option.

nm-openvpn[257279]: OPTIONS ERROR: failed to negotiate cipher with server.  Add 
the server's cipher ('AES-256-CBC') to --data-ciphers (currently 
'AES-256-GCM:AES-128-GCM:CHACHA20-POLY1305') if you want to connect to this 
server.
nm-openvpn[257279]: ERROR: Failed to apply push options
nm-openvpn[257279]: Failed to open tun/tap interface

Using the command line and passing --data-ciphers option works.
